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Braintree Freeport to Glengarnock start from as little as £45.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Braintree Freeport to Glengarnock start from £104.60 one way, or £214.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Braintree Freeport to Glengarnock are available for £133.30 one way, or £451.40 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Braintree Freeport train station might be small, but it ensures travelers can manage their journeys with ease. The station doesn't have a ticket office, but it does have accessible ticket machines. These machines allow passengers to collect tickets bought online, saving time and providing added convenience. They’re designed to cater to all needs with induction loops available for those requiring hearing assistance.

While the station lacks waiting rooms and toilets, it makes up for these omissions with a seating area on the single platform, offering step-free access. Notably, assistance meeting points and ramps for train boarding ensure accessibility for all. CCTV surveillance provides an added layer of safety for commuters.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

The station might not be a hub for cycling or car parking, with limited bicycle storage and no car park facilities, but it is excellently positioned near the Braintree Village shopping centre. This proximity offers travelers plentiful shopping options and amenities. Additionally, rail replacement services conveniently pick up and drop off at the nearby bus stops, ensuring connectivity even during disruptions.

Facilities at Glengarnock Station

Operating with customer convenience in mind, Glengarnock Train Station offers robust facilities for both ticket purchasing and passenger support. The ticket office is open from Monday to Saturday, 07:15 to 14:19, though it's closed on Sundays.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available and are accessible to all customers, including those with mobility impairments.

The station is fitted with helpful customer information systems, including departure screens and audio announcements. For further assistance, the staff is present during weekdays with a customer help point readily available for queries. Notably, the station integrates accessibility features like step-free access to certain areas, induction loops, seating areas, and ramps, ensuring a more seamless travel experience for everyone.

Travel Connections and Accessibility

Glengarnock is well-connected with several transport options to ease your onward journey. Local buses are conveniently accessed from the Main Street, B777, and details about these services can be found on Traveline Scotland. Should you need a taxi, services can be arranged via TrainTaxi. Additionally, the station accommodates bicycle enthusiasts with storage facilities and the option to hire bicycles from RT Cycles & Fishing located nearby.

Parking is no hassle with accessible and free spaces available 24 hours a day. Despite lacking direct accessible taxis, travelers can plan their route with confidence using the assistance program, Passenger Assist, which allows bookings up to two hours before travel.
